Future stars take track at USA Youth Championships
6/25/2012
ARLINGTON- Over 2500 of the country’s top young athletes will compete at the 2012
USA Youth Outdoor Track & Field Championships June 26 – July 1, 2012 in Arlington, TX
at Maverick Stadium on the campus of University of Texas, Arlington.
The 2012 USA Youth Outdoor Track & Field Championships will return to where it began;
as Arlington, TX was the first location for this event in 1989. These National Championships
will feature athletes between the ages 7-18 competing in six, two-year age divisions. Team
Championships will be awarded in every age division providing youth clubs the opportunity
to come together on a national stage.
Participation is up 25% from the 2011 competition and is the highest participation level in
the last six years. This will also be the first year this competition will include international
athletes. A small contingent of four athletes and three coaches has been approved for
participation by USATF and the Brazilian Athletics Confederation in an effort to promote
cultural exchange in youth athletics.

. Athletes to watch include:
In the Sub-Bantam girls division, Track Houston TC brings another 4x400m to try to hold on to their national record of 5:05.18.
Two Sub-Bantam national record holders return to compete in the Bantam girls division. Dynasty McClennon (Track Houston TC), the 2011 200m Sub-Bantam national record holder, will return to try to claim another title in the 100m. Sub-Bantam national record holder in the 800m, Courtney Wilmington (The Wings Track Club, Inc.) comes into the competition with the third fastest seed time of 2:40.00. Alyssa Harris (Cedar Hill Blaze Track Club) comes in with the fastest time at 2:35.
National and Junior Olympic record holder Raevyn Rodgers is returning to the Youth Championships as an Intermediate girl. A veteran of the program, Rodgers holds records in the 800m in the Midget and Youth age divisions. Rodgers returns to compete in the 400m.
On the boy’s side, Jadan Miller Jones (Texas Torch TC) is a double event threat, as he comes in with the top seeded times in the Sub-Bantam 200m (27.50) and long jump (4.16m/13-8). Miller Jones will try to break 2011 Sub-Bantam national record holder, Matthew Medill’s mark in the long jump. Meanwhile, Medill (Lincoln Jets) will return to compete at the Bantam division in the long jump.
The 2011 Bantam high jump national record holder, Sean Lee (USA High Jump Club) also returns to action in the Midget division. Lee’s jump of (1.76m/5-9.25) gives him the top seed going into the competition.
